Genesis 34:8
8And Hamor communed with them, saying, The soul of my son Shechem longeth for your daughter: I pray you give her him to wife.
8And Hamor communed with them, saying, The soule of my sonne Shechem longeth for your daughter: I pray you giue her him to wife.
Genesis 34:9
9And make ye marriages with us, and give your daughters unto us, and take our daughters unto you.
9And make ye mariages with vs, and giue your daughters vnto vs, and take our daughters vnto you.
Genesis 34:10
10And ye shall dwell with us: and the land shall be before you; dwell and trade ye therein, and get you possessions therein.
10And ye shall dwell with vs, and the land shall be before you: dwell and trade you therein, and get you possessions therein.
